![]() |
Datenbank: MySQL • Version: 4 • Zugriff über: MyDAC
ADODB Recordset mit Delphi5
Hi liebe DP'ler,
ich habe folgendes Problem: Ich habe mein Programm an ein Com+ Objekt angebunden. Das hat auch wunderbar geklappt. Eine Funktion des Com Objekts liefert mir einen Recordset zurück. In VB kann ich das so lösen: Set Versand = New ttDispatch.Dispatch Dim RS As ADODB.Recordset Set RS = Versand.CheckProject(128) in Delphi habe ich:
Delphi-Quellcode:
wie muss ich MYRECORDSET definieren, damit das funktioniert???
procedure TForm1.Button1Click(Sender: TObject);
var Versand : TDispatch; begin MYRECORDSET := Versand.CheckProject(128); end; Grüße Benjamin |
Re: ADODB Recordset mit Delphi5
Zitat:
In einem OleVariant hast du dann ein IDispatch Interface-Pointer. |
Re: ADODB Recordset mit Delphi5
Hi, danke für deine Hilfe, aber ich hab mit Records bisher noch nicht gearbeitet. Kannst du mir auf die Sprünge helfen.
Delphi-Quellcode:
funktioniert nämlich nicht.
RS : Record as OleVariant;
Und wenn ich
Delphi-Quellcode:
mache und dann eine Zuweisung über:
type RS = Record
Test : OleVariant;
Delphi-Quellcode:
bringt er mir den Fehler "Objekt oder Klassentyp erforderlich". Was ja auch logisch ist.
RS.test := Versand.CheckProject(128);
Grüße Ben |
Re: ADODB Recordset mit Delphi5
Wenn ich Tomaten auf den Augen habe, dann richtig.
Also es klappt jetzt. Dank dir für die Hilfe. |
Alle Zeitangaben in WEZ +1. Es ist jetzt 23:12 Uhr. |
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
LinkBacks Enabled by vBSEO © 2011, Crawlability, Inc.
Delphi-PRAXiS (c) 2002 - 2023 by Daniel R. Wolf, 2024-2025 by Thomas Breitkreuz